Suella Braverman fears more 'shocking cases' of corrupt cops will emerge as she tells forces to root out any David Carrick cases
Suella Braverman fears more cases like David Carrick's will emerge.Home secretary Suella Braverman fears more "shocking cases" of police corruption and abuse will come to light in the wake of David Carrick's rape admission.
Carrick, who has now been formally sacked from the Met, admitted a string sex crimes including 24 counts of rape on Monday. "It's a matter of the utmost importance that there are robust processes in place to stop the wrong people joining the police in the first place. She said bureaucracy and processes appeared to have "prevailed over ethics and common sense" so she had announced an internal review into police dismissals, with the terms of reference published today.
